West Virginia Code § 19-12D-4

Administration of article; promulgation of regulations

(a) The commissioner shall administer and enforce the provisions of this article and shall
have authority to issue regulations after a public hearing following due notice to all
interested persons in conformance with the provisions of the state administrative procedures
set forth in chapter twenty-nine- a of this code.
(b) In issuing such regulations, the commissioner shall give consideration to pertinent
research findings and recommendations of other agencies of the state, the federal
government, and other reliable sources.
